I have been using ppo and sns for quite some time now.
Pros . sns = very transparent in charges., you can depend on anuradha to sort out issues if any. Charges are OK. And they charge on actual weight basis.
Cons .- they use a broker for customs clearance, who is unreliable. Sns does not directly get involved in the customs scene. nd of mile delivery, where the parcel gets delivered to you at your home is very poor, they should do something about it.
Ppo - pro - very good if you are getting cellphones and small items. Charges are low.
Cons - you are charged duty, but no proof if its actually been paid by them to the customs. They charge on volumetric basis.but if item is heavy and small, you get charged on weight basis, so either way you are screwed. So anything that you get in a box or carton will get charged on volume.

So finally, if want to import bulky and light weight tems use sns.
If small packages, use ppo.
